Engaging Indigenous people within Higher Ed

CQUniversity's Office of Indigenous Engagement recently hosted a visit from the Oodgeroo Unit of Queensland University of Technology (QUT), at Rockhampton Campus.

Professor Anita Lee Hong, Director of the Oodgeroo Unit, and Lone Pearce, Project Officer, met with Office of Indigenous Engagement staff to discuss employment issues and best practice models for engaging Indigenous people within the higher education sector, including governance matters.

CQU reps at conference for international education specialists 

Staff members from CQU Sydney and Rockhampton campuses met up at the recent ISANA National Conference held at UNSW, Sydney.

ISANA is the representative body for international education professionals who work in student services, advocacy, teaching, and policy development.

PhotoID:3792 Professor Ross Lehman (pictured), Linda Moalem-Wilhelmi, Carina Carmody and Rohan Peterson from CQU Sydney took part.

They were joined by 2 staff members from CQU Rockhampton: Robyn Bailey and Ross Munro.

Also attending were Andrew Roberts and Denise Roberts from C Management Services Divisional Office at the Gold Coast.

The conference theme of 'Educate, Advocate Empower' was reflected in the range of presentations.

Considerable input was provided by staff from Australian Education International and the Federal departments of Education and Immigration.

There was a focus on the forthcoming changes to the ESOS code, with useful recommendations for future staff development.

Professor Ross Lehman successfully presented a paper (in the Policy into Practice stream) entitled 'This is how we do it!'.

His paper was based on primary data collected from Academic Staff Professional Development seminars held in 2005 and 2006 on CQU campuses at the Gold Coast (with Brisbane), Sydney and Melbourne, Networking was encouraged throughout the program.
